[Git][noosfero/noosfero][master] elasticsearch: fix testing on travis
Bráulio Bhavamitra
gitlab at mg.gitlab.com
Sun Aug 7 19:09:37 BRT 2016
Bráulio Bhavamitra pushed to branch master at Noosfero / noosfero
Commits:
011d76b5 by Braulio Bhavamitra at 2016-08-07T19:08:57-03:00
elasticsearch: fix testing on travis
- - - - -
3 changed files:
- .travis.yml
- plugins/elasticsearch/after_disable.rb
- plugins/elasticsearch/install.rb
Changes:
=====================================
.travis.yml
=====================================
--- a/.travis.yml
+++ b/.travis.yml
@@ -20,6 +20,10 @@ language: ruby
rvm:
- 2.3.1
+services:
+ - postgresql
+ - elasticsearch
+
addons:
apt:
packages:
=====================================
plugins/elasticsearch/after_disable.rb
=====================================
--- a/plugins/elasticsearch/after_disable.rb
+++ b/plugins/elasticsearch/after_disable.rb
@@ -6,4 +6,6 @@ Dir[tasks_dir].each do |file|
load file
end
-Rake.application['stop'].invoke
+unless ENV['TRAVIS']
+ Rake.application['stop'].invoke
+end
=====================================
plugins/elasticsearch/install.rb
=====================================
--- a/plugins/elasticsearch/install.rb
+++ b/plugins/elasticsearch/install.rb
@@ -6,4 +6,6 @@ Dir[tasks_dir].each do |file|
load file
end
-Rake.application['start'].invoke
+unless ENV['TRAVIS']
+ Rake.application['start'].invoke
+end
View it on GitLab: https://gitlab.com/noosfero/noosfero/commit/011d76b5991d88e8a661065c017e4ade3912ce8e
-------------- next part --------------
An HTML attachment was scrubbed...
URL: <http://listas.softwarelivre.org/pipermail/noosfero-dev/attachments/20160807/ddba8726/attachment-0001.html>
More information about the Noosfero-dev
mailing list